I've got an M37 with a hybrid 12/24V system which I will be switching to all 24V. It currently has a 12V Quardratech Q9000 winch connected to one of the two 12V batteries. I'm not crazy about that kind of set up. I'm considering replacing it with a 24V electric winch.
Is a 9000# size a good match for an M37, or should I be taking this opportunity to switch sizes as well?
So far, about all I've found in 24V is the Warn Series 9 DC Industrial Winch, 24V, 9,000 lb (model 30284). It sells for about $1725, without fairlead, wire rope, or tensioner.
I'm not sure if putting a stock PTO winch on there is in the near-term cards for me at this point. Willing to consider options, however.
